Sizzlespine was a NOVUZEIT effect, but like the rest of the NOVUZEIT stuff it's no longer available (except for the SE source code).
It used to sell for $19.95 ... |

Am I allowed to upload it? I have it loaded in SE right now, looks complete, I was thinking it might have an old EVM Lfo while I have the new ones.
It's pretty basic, stock clipper, delay, waveshaper. He blanked out all the module names so you have to know what it is or right click and make sure. That's why I never did anything with it. |

The license explicitly says you can't recompile the unchanged software, then sell it. If Jack meant to say "or give it away" I think he would have. Seems to me I or someone eventually asked him this and he said it was okay long as it was sharing instead of selling.
Jack did mention that his intention in releasing the sources was to promote learning and experimentation, with the disclaimer that the projects weren't made as learning tools so some things might be obscure.
